The light-footed Cantagal from the pen of Barni flows into the glass with brilliant golden yellow. To the nose, this Barni dessert wine reveals all sorts of apricots. As if that were not already impressive, further aromas such as honey are added by the aging in large wooden barrels.
The light-footed Barni Cantagal reveals an incredibly fruit-driven taste to us on the tongue, which is not least due to its residual sweet flavor profile. On the tongue, this light-footed dessert wine is characterized by an incredibly dense, silky, creamy and velvety texture. Finally, on the finish, this wine from the wine-growing region of Piedmont delights with beautiful length. Again, hints of apricot appear. In the aftertaste, mineral notes of the soils dominated by clay and volcanic rock are added.
Vinification of Barni Cantagal
The basis for the elegant Cantagal from Italy are grapes from the grape variety Erbaluce. In Piedmont, the vines that produce the grapes for this wine grow on soils of clay and volcanic rock. After harvesting, the grapes are immediately sent to the winery. Here they are selected and carefully crushed. Fermentation follows in stainless steel tanks and large wood at controlled temperatures. After its end, the Cantagal can further harmonize for 42 months on the fine lees.
Serving Suggestions for Barni's Cantagal
This Italian is best enjoyed moderately chilled at 11 - 13°C. It is perfect as an accompaniment to peach-passion fruit dessert, almond milk jelly with lychees, or pear-lime strudel.
